Robert Half Sr. Accountant in Houston, Texas
Description Do you enjoy working in a challenging and fast-paced culture? Do you aspire to become part of a reputable company? If you answered yes, Robert Half may have the perfect role. As a Senior Accountant, you will be tasked with financial statement preparation and consolidation, account analysis and reconciliations, cash flow analysis, budgets and forecasting, audit preparation, and internal control maintenance and regulatory reporting. What you get to do every single day
Prepare Balance Sheet account reconciliations
Work with business partners to ensure compliance with corporate accounting policies, procedures and controls and provide support on special requests
Manage Ad-hoc projects as necessary
Produce monthly consolidated P& L and Balance Sheet flux analysis for management purposes
Offer involvement in various department-wide initiatives
Review financial information such as trends, performance metrics, benchmarks, etc. and present analysis in a clear manner
Dedication to continuously improve the automation of the accounting and reporting process
Aid in coordinating quarterly reviews and testing with internal and external auditors
Produce error-free monthly accounting close procedures and deliverables such as journal entries, reconciliations, reports in compliance with GAAP Requirements - Self-driven motivator who takes initiative on projects with a strong ability to understand and solve creative challenges
